OK I have just had a thought and bandied it around with the guys.. The general concensus is that it will do no harm but may work.. If you are willing to give it a go ?

Open an elevated command prompt
Go Start >  All Programs > Accessories
Right click command prompt and select run as administrator
In the black box type :

sc delete BITS

Reboot the computer

Then merge the bits reg file (if you still have it)
